6/30/21 - This is a very nice example of a Sauer 38h issued to the Nazi military during WW2. It is all matching and has the proper "Eagle 37" military proof. It has retained somewhere between 85-90% of its original finish. Most of the wear is on the straps, but there are also hints of wear on the high edges of the slide. Some light spotty wear on the right side of the slide. Spotty oxidation the left side of the slide and on the straps. Front sight is painted. Comes with excellent grips and a period-correct grips. Mint bore.
